TDOA Passive Geolocation System
TDOA Passive Geolocation System deployment showing sensor nodes and control interface
The TDOA Passive Geolocation System is a passive geolocation device for low-altitude targets based on Time Difference of Arrival (TDOA) technology. Utilizing a multi-node acoustic/RF sensor array, the system captures signals emitted or acoustic waves generated by low-altitude targets—primarily UAVs—and calculates target coordinates with high precision by measuring the time differences in signal arrival across different sensor nodes. This enables passive detection, geolocation, and trajectory tracking of "low, slow, and small" (LSS) targets. The system requires no active signal transmission, offering core advantages including strong stealth capability, zero electromagnetic interference (EMI), and high positioning accuracy. It can be deployed independently or seamlessly integrated into broader low-altitude defense architectures, providing precise target location cuing for countermeasure systems. Widely deployed in sensitive facilities, airport clearance zones, border outposts, major event venues, and other critical areas, the system fills the passive geolocation gap in low-altitude defense and completes the low-altitude security situational awareness framework.
Core Product Features
Passive Geolocation with Exceptional Stealth
  • Employs TDOA passive geolocation architecture
  • Passively receives target signals only (UAV remote control signals, rotor acoustic signatures, etc.)
  • Transmits no active RF or detection signals of any kind
  • Zero electromagnetic radiation; inherently difficult to detect
  • Ideally suited for covert security operations in sensitive and classified zones
High-Precision Localization with Controlled Error Margins
  • Leverages multi-node sensor arrays combined with high-precision time synchronization technology
  • High geolocation accuracy with planar positioning error ≤5 meters
  • Precisely locks onto target coordinates and flight trajectories
  • Provides accurate data support for follow-on countermeasure deployment
